9aushad )hmed Khan, president of 5ndian Young 6awyers )ssociation whose women members had filed the 456, mentioned the matter before the bench, e-pressing his desire to w ithdraw the plea in the wake of several intimidating calls and death threats allegedly received by him. /ut the bench told him the 456 of such a nature cannot be withdrawn at this stage. )dding that it may appoint an amicus, the court said it would take up on onday issues relating to security of Khan, who is also an additional standing counsel for the +elhi government. 7arlier this week, the ! bench had $uestioned the ban on entry of women of menstrual age group in !abarimala temple, saying it was a public temple and everyone needed to have &the right to access(.

A Division Bench of the Kerala HC had upheld the restriction on women of a particular age group offering worship at the shrine. In a submission that may indicate the 1erala government"s position on access to women aged between '( and )( to the Sabarimala shrine, the State as.ed the Supreme Court on Monday to call for the records of a '<<' judgment of the 1erala =igh Court, which held that the restriction was in accordance with a usage from time immemorial and not discriminatory under the Constitution* # Division ench of the 1erala =C had, on #pril ), '<<', e6amined the Sabarimala 5hanthri $chief priest% and upheld the restriction on women of a particular age group offering worship at the shrine* 5he =C ench of -ustices 1* Paripoornan and 1** Marar held that the prohibition imposed by the 5ravancore Devaswom oard was not violative of #rticles '), A) and AB of the Constitution* Neither was it violative of the provisions of the =indu Places of Public 7orship $#uthorisation of ?ntry% #ct, '
# Division ench of the 1erala =igh Court had e6amined him on #pril ), '<<', before it upheld the restriction on women of that age group offering worship at the Sabarimala shrine* Summon records Senior advocate * >iri, appearing for 1erala, urged the special three+judge ench led by -ustice Dipa. Misra to summon the records of the '<<' case* /#ccording to him, these customs and usages had to be followed for the welfare of the temple* =e said only persons who had observed penance and followed the customs are eligible to enter the temple and it is not proper for young women to do so,0 the '<<' judgment had said* 5wenty+five years after this =igh Court judgment, the Supreme Court has &uestioned the /logic0 behind the restriction, even wondering whether there was any proof that women did not enter the sanctum sanctorum ',)(( years ago* 1eywords; an on women"s entry in Sabarimala
